Our hypothesis was that preserved cartilage in osteoarthritic (OA) joints is thicker compared to non-OA joints. We took the femorotibial joint as a model. First, we determined that Computed Tomography arthrography (CTA) is the imaging modality with the highest sensitivity and interobserver agreement for the detection of cartilage surface lesions. Second, we analyzed sources of interobserver disagreement for the grading of cartilage at CTA. Third, we identified a target area of cartilage that is frequently preserved in knee OA until late stages of the disease, at the posterior aspect of the medial condyle. Finally, we showed that cartilage thickness at the posterior aspect of the medial condyle is increased in OA knees compared to non-OA knees, and that this thickening is correlated to the grade of OA.
